Proponents of embryonic stem cell research proclaim the potential of the research to find cures or treatments for many diseases such as Parkinson’s and Parkinson’s. Opponents say the use and destruction of human embryos in the conduct of this research are immoral. In 2001, President Bush announced a ban on federal funding involving any new lines of embryonic stem cells. But calls to lift the ban continue, as do movements to increase funding at the state level.
